Parkersburg: A Hidden Gem by the Ohio River
Explore Parkersburg, West Virginia – a charming city by the Ohio River, rich with history, natural beauty, and vibrant local culture offering unforgettable experiences.
Nestled along the serene banks of the Ohio River, Parkersburg is a city rich with history and charm. This quaint locale in West Virginia offers a perfect blend of natural beauty, historical landmarks, and a welcoming community. As you stroll through the streets, you'll find echoes of the city's past in its beautifully preserved Victorian architecture and museums. For history buffs, the Blennerhassett Island Historical State Park is a must-visit. This island, accessible by sternwheeler riverboat, offers a glimpse into the lives of Harman and Margaret Blennerhassett, who played a significant role in early American history. The Blennerhassett Mansion, with its guided tours, provides an immersive experience into the 18th century. Nature enthusiasts will revel in the lush landscapes and outdoor activities that Parkersburg has to offer. The North Bend Rail Trail and Mountwood Park provide excellent opportunities for hiking, biking, and picnicking. The city’s proximity to the Ohio River also makes it ideal for fishing and boating. Parkersburg’s local culture is vibrant and welcoming. The city hosts various festivals and events throughout the year, celebrating everything from its storied past to contemporary arts and crafts. The downtown area is home to unique shops, local eateries, and cozy cafes, perfect for a leisurely day of exploration. Whether you're a history lover, nature enthusiast, or just looking to experience small-town America, Parkersburg has something for everyone. Its unique blend of past and present creates a captivating destination worth discovering.

History of Parkersburg
-
Parkersburg, originally known as Newport, was incorporated in 1810. The city is named after Alexander Parker, a prominent early settler. Early settlers were attracted by the fertile lands and the strategic location along the Ohio River, which made it an ideal spot for trade and transportation.
-
In the mid-19th century, Parkersburg became a significant center for the oil and gas industry. The discovery of oil in nearby Burning Springs in 1860 led to a boom that transformed the local economy. Parkersburg served as a key supply and transportation hub during this period.
-
During the American Civil War, Parkersburg was of strategic importance due to its location along the Ohio River and the Baltimore and Ohio Railroad. The Union Army established Camp Cairo in Parkersburg, which served as a crucial supply depot and staging area for movements into the South.
-
The arrival of the Baltimore and Ohio Railroad in 1857 spurred industrial growth in Parkersburg. The city became a transportation nexus, facilitating the movement of goods and people. This period saw the growth of manufacturing industries, including glass, chemicals, and textiles, which contributed to the city's prosperity.
-
Located in the Ohio River, Blennerhassett Island is a significant historical site linked to Parkersburg. In the early 19th century, Harman Blennerhassett and his wife Margaret built a mansion on the island, which became the center of a controversial plot led by Aaron Burr. The restored mansion and island are now a state park and a popular tourist attraction.
-
Parkersburg has experienced significant flooding due to its proximity to the Ohio River. The floods of 1913 and 1937 were particularly devastating, causing extensive damage to homes, businesses, and infrastructure. These events prompted the construction of flood control measures, which have since protected the city from similar disasters.
-
In recent decades, Parkersburg has diversified its economy beyond its traditional industrial base. The city has focused on developing sectors such as healthcare, education, and tourism. The revitalization of the downtown area and the establishment of cultural institutions like the Parkersburg Art Center have contributed to the city's modern renaissance.
Parkersburg Essentials
-
Parkersburg is located in the northwestern region of West Virginia. The nearest major airport is Mid-Ohio Valley Regional Airport (PKB), which is just a short drive from the city. Alternatively, you can fly into Yeager Airport (CRW) in Charleston, WV, which is about 80 miles away. From either airport, you can rent a car or take a taxi to reach Parkersburg. Additionally, Greyhound buses service the area, and you can also arrive by Amtrak, with the nearest station being in Huntington, WV.
-
Parkersburg has a variety of transportation options. Public buses operated by the Mid-Ohio Valley Transit Authority (MOVTA) cover many parts of the city. Taxis and rideshare services like Uber and Lyft are also available. For those who prefer to drive, car rentals are easily accessible. The city is relatively small, and many attractions are within walking distance in the downtown area.
-
The official currency in Parkersburg, as in the rest of the United States, is the US Dollar (USD). Credit and debit cards are widely accepted in most places, including hotels, restaurants, and shops. ATMs are plentiful, so you can easily withdraw cash if needed. However, it is always a good idea to carry some cash for small purchases, especially in local markets or smaller establishments.
-
Parkersburg is generally a safe city, but like any urban area, it is wise to take standard precautions. Avoid walking alone at night in unfamiliar areas and keep an eye on your belongings in crowded places. The areas around downtown and the historic district are usually safe, but exercise caution in less populated neighborhoods. Always stay aware of your surroundings and trust your instincts.
-
In case of an emergency, dial 911 for immediate assistance. The Camden Clark Medical Center is the primary hospital in Parkersburg and provides comprehensive medical care. For minor health issues, there are numerous pharmacies throughout the city. Make sure you have travel insurance that covers medical emergencies. Local police and fire departments are efficient and responsive.
